How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Windcrest?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Windcrest Studio Apartments | $975 | $750 | $1,143 |
| Windcrest 1 Bedroom Apartments | $939 | $599 | $2,120 |
| Windcrest 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,201 | $791 | $2,380 |
| Windcrest 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,492 | $895 | $2,939 |
| Windcrest 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,522 | $1,450 | $1,599 |

Frequently Asked Questions about 1 Bedroom Windcrest Apartments
How much is the average rent for a 1 Bedroom Windcrest Apartment?
The average rent for a 1 Bedroom Apartment in Windcrest is $939.
What is the largest available 1 Bedroom Windcrest Apartment for rent?
Today's apartment with the most square footage in Windcrest is a 900 square feet unit starting from $899 at Avistar At The Parkway.
What is the average size for Windcrest 1 Bedroom Apartments for rent?
The average size for a 1 Bedroom rental in Windcrest is currently 918 sq ft.
